Abstract

The embodiment of the utility model discloses a derating test device which comprises a test unit for the derating test, a control unit used for enabling the test unit to carry out the derating test and connected with the test unit and an output unit used for outputting the derating test results and connected with the test unit. By adopting the embodiment of the utility model, the derating test can be carried out to televisions and electronic components in the televisions, so as to enable a designer to design more reasonable applying components, thereby improving the applying reliability of the components and the stability of the derating test device.

Background technology
The design of television set must guarantee also that except will intactly going back the signal of reason TV station transmission television set has certain reliability, promptly will guarantee its failsafe in the regular hour, and being out of order does not damage environment, human body on every side.Reliability design-derate test is exactly to add the derate of components and parts utilization is tested in the test of television set, makes the utilization of components and parts more reliable, more reasonable.
Derate test is exactly that stress that the components and parts of working in television set (are watched) in its normal range of operation is lower than the specified stress of these components and parts under operational environment at that time.Stress has voltage, electric current, power, temperature, frequency, pressure, humidity or the like in the category of electronic component, what we considered for the electronic component in the television set mainly is voltage, electric current, temperature, power, frequency, and stress is measurable data." the specified stress under the operational environment at that time " generally is not meant the value of being indicated in the component specification book, the value of indicating in the specifications is not used under our television set " operational environment at that time " condition generally speaking, at this moment just can only serve as with the mark condition of component specification book with reference to or convert.
But in the prior art, to carry out the inspection of a lot of aspects after the design of television set is finished and be exactly inspection and the evaluation that does not have the derate aspect, thereby make except that the designer or the designer might not know that components and parts use irrational part in the television set, have reduced the reliability of television set.

Fig. 2 is the structural representation of test cell 2 preferred embodiments among the utility model embodiment, comprising:
Be used for the system test unit 201 of derate test Overall Power Consumption and stand-by power consumption, Overall Power Consumption is an important indicator of television set, and the consumed power of the television set of certain size has certain limit, and is excessive for avoiding Overall Power Consumption, do test.Overall Power Consumption is irrational excessive, must be the loss that inaction is arranged in the TV set circuit, and this loss has comprised that design is unreasonable, incorrect with element, television set is adjusted incorrect or element quality has problem or the like reason.Preferred version is a TV signal of choosing a standard, and 80% of rated value is chosen in sound accompaniment, uses the 1KHz sine wave, and television set watches that in standard state removes to test Overall Power Consumption.
Stand-by power consumption is our energy consumption index, is a restriction to energy savings.Go to make the television set standby can survey stand-by power consumption with remote control
The complete machine high-low pressure that is used for the derate test starts the high-low pressure startup test cell 202 of function, we start test cell 202 with minimum value that is lower than rated voltage and the maximum that is higher than rated voltage by high-low pressure, television set is arranged on the mains switch switching on and shutting down of standard operation state, remote control switch test, can checks that especially it is reducing the low voltage starting ability behind the stand-by power consumption.
The sound output test cell 203 that is used for derate testing audio power output, because the sound accompaniment modulation degree difference that each TV station sends, under the identical volume index indication of television set, output power of speaker is different, if it is excessive except meeting influences the load of power discharging IC, load to power supply also can increase the weight of, and also might produce mechanical oscillation, and this all is to violate us to design wish.Therefore our preferred version be under the sound accompaniment maximum percentage modulation, tv volume index full scale, go the peak power output of test horn by sound power output test cell 203 usefulness 1KHz sine waves.
Be used for the picture tube test cell 204 of derate test picture tube, the derate test that 204 pairs of picture tubes of picture tube test cell carry out mainly is the continuous variation at picture tube.Recently picture tube is in continuous variation, and is from common sphere pipe to flat tube, right angle, pure flat, super flat, 50Hz, 100Hz, short tube, a ultrashort pipe generation, ultrashort Guan Erdai, big or small in addition from 14 cun to 34 cun etc.The deflection current of various picture tubes is all different.
Under the situation of brightness, contrast maximum, measure row, vertical yoke current peak-to-peak value, can predict the current peak of line pipe, estimate that the nominal parameter symbol of line pipe is undesirable from horizontal deflection current peak peak value.Can check from the vertical yoke current peak-to-peak value whether the output current of an IC is lower than the rated value of an IC.
The voltage and current peak value that is used for derate test line pipe, the line pipe test cell 205 of waveform and power consumption, wherein, line pipe test cell 205 is at first to the voltage of line pipe collector electrode, current peak detects, the brightness of television set, contrast is got to maximum, selected standard signal, sandwich voltage probe, current probe just can be measured the collector voltage of line pipe under maximum rating, the peak value of electric current, more just know that with the rated value of line pipe can line pipe that we use operate as normal under this television set, in addition also will check the safety operation area of line pipe sometimes, the respective value of inscribing when same with voltage and electric current is removed the SOA curve in the comparison line pipe specifications exactly.
The voltage of line pipe collector electrode, current waveform detect, this detection is just so uneasy, it will be according to the tester to being familiar with of line pipe operating circuit, to being familiar with of the element of line-scan circuit, parameter, being familiar with, the situation of television set reliability testing is familiar with the waveform of line-scan circuit each point, also to also to be familiar with simultaneously the understanding of picture tube to the production of various types, feedback pre-sales, after sale.Can find out when bad from the voltage of line pipe collector electrode, quality, particularly operating state that current waveform can roughly be judged the line pipe operating state are obvious.
The detection of waveform just is a slight variation sometimes, does not also see the radian of the variation what is big, slight bent angle, trailing edge, and easy ordinary wave more a little is moving, and these all may make line pipe too early end useful life.Except the voltage of line pipe collector electrode, current waveform are detected, sometimes also will be to voltage, the current waveform inspection of line pipe base stage, and the operating state inspection that promotes of row.
(little does not see unusually sometimes after voltage, current waveform detection to the line pipe collector electrode do not have to find very big abnormal conditions, sometimes or even reasonably), also will be to the dissipation power inspection of line pipe, use the power consumption of oscillographic mathematical operation functional test line pipe, when the power consumption of finding line pipe is excessive, check a series of activities parameters such as work wave, circuit parameter, collector waveform fall time, base stage memory time of line pipe again conversely.Also will test the temperature rise of line pipe in case of necessity, those are again after television set work a few hours.
The power supply test unit 206 that is used for derate testing power supply switching tube and/or power supply IC, voltage, current peak that power supply test unit 206 can be used for testing power supply IC and power supply switch tube high pressure input pin detect, also can measure power supply switch tube or the voltage and current of power supply IC under maximum rating, load this moment also should be arranged on maximum rating.
The detection of voltage and current waveform be will according to the application note of specifications and in the past this type of machine precision waveform under normal operative condition observe comparison; note linearity, spike, vibration, level and smooth, unusual etc. generally speaking; it also has the scope of SOA for the power supply pipe; though for component parameters standardization around the power supply IC but also will suitably adjust sometimes; such as adjusting stand-by power consumption; over-current over-voltage protection, EMI interference etc.
The correction tube test cell 207 that is used for derate test correction tube, correction tube test cell 207 is used to test voltage, the current waveform of correction tube, wherein the voltage of correction tube, current waveform flip-flop weigh, voltage waveform generally is exactly the sine wave of band modulation, current waveform is just somewhat different, that is that designers are according to the isoparametric generation that differs of design, pipe arrangement, the adjustment of circuit, if linearity of raster, high pressure, etc. running parameter determine it is acceptable, subjective assessment is passed through again, as long as pipe arrangement is proofreaied and correct, that has also just passed through in the derate test.
The power supply secondary commutation pipe test cell 208 that is used for derate testing power supply secondary commutation pipe, can be by the output loading of power supply secondary commutation pipe test cell 208 testing power supply secondary commutation pipes, select power supply secondary commutation pipe, ordinary circumstance is that surplus is all greater than the rated value of device, but all accidents of the rectifying tube of some low pressure, be familiar with seeing model after the circuit, seeing the circuit purposes is just known to use.But have several problems to note:
The B+ rectifying tube will be noted its electric current, and the leeway of selection needs big, and just unlikely heating is excessive, there is no harm in two in parallel uses when not satisfying temperature rise sometimes;
The rectifying tube of digiboard power supply is directly to supply digiboard sometimes, and electric current is bigger, note choosing.Rectifying tube heating also can be big, select low pressure drop.By voltage stabilizing IC for digiboard to note voltage stabilizing IC input voltage size, note to reduce input voltage on the one hand, reduce the pressure drop of voltage stabilizing IC, will guarantee when standby, to have enough input voltages to give voltage stabilizing IC on the other hand, stable work is arranged to guarantee digiboard;
The distribution of electric current as far as possible evenly allows electric current that rectifying tube undertakes all in certain ratio, not Chong weight, light too light again;
The voltage stabilizing IC and the DC-DC test cell 209 that are used for derate test voltage stabilizing IC and DC-DC, the power consumption of the pressure drop of voltage stabilizing IC and DC-DC test cell 209 each voltage stabilizing of test IC, output current, calculating voltage stabilizing IC is measured DC-DC output current and output voltage to check the carrying load ability of DC-DC.
The power resistor test cell 210 that is used for derate measured power resistance, 210 pairs of power of power resistor test cell are all done the derate test basically more than or equal to the resistance of 2W, and the derate ratio is selected in 1/2, and promptly the resistance of 2W rated value only is used in the circuit of 1W, by that analogy.Fusing resistor, protective resistance are not chosen like this.(with current related) meeting heating that the use power of resistance is big, and have influence on peripheral element.The resistance of some 1W, 1/2W will be noted its electric current and voltage, if big also will suitably the adjusting of electric current and voltage.
The capacity measurement unit 211 that is used for the derate testing capacitor, capacity measurement unit 211 is used for inspection of testing capacitor operating voltage and ripple current, wherein, ripple current is the main cause that causes the electric capacity heating, because the electrolyte of the alminium electrolytic condenser inside in the television set is not fire proofing, overweight when load occurring, electric capacity heating causing inefficacy, cracking even blast, the electrolyte that ignites also can happen occasionally.Mainly the lower pressure rectifier filter capacitor of input rectifying filter capacitor, transformer secondary output B+ rectifying and wave-filtering electric capacity, big electric current, the large-current electric of pincushion correction circuitry are held inspection etc., again with conversion after the electric capacity ripple current relatively, can tentatively determine whether selecting for use appropriately of electric capacity.It is just passable generally to be no more than its rated voltage 80% for the operating voltage of electric capacity.
Since ripple current directly influence be the temperature rise of electric capacity, so measure the situation of selecting for use that the temperature rise of electric capacity also can be checked electric capacity, will both check that under doubt situation ripple current also checks temperature rise.
Be used for derate test field IC, look the IC test cell 212 of putting IC, 212 couples of field IC of IC test cell, look and put IC and carry out the derate test, this only does general inspection, the rated value that is no more than IC is just passable.Sometimes the temperature rise of an IC is relevant with operating voltage, has no idea again this moment to adjust, adjust to change switch transformer, and be major issue.That will equilibrium once, can remove to change the field IC of another kind of model or strengthen radiator area and solve.Look and put IC or look to put pipe mainly be problem of temperature rise, derate was not found any problem.
